Rutherford backscattering spectroscopy and surface morphology of amorphous AS(2)Se(3) films modified with complex compounds Ln(THD)(3) (Ln = Eu, Tb, Er, Yb)

摘要

in this work we report the results on study of amorphous As2Se3 films modified with rare-earth dipivaloylmethanates Ln(THD)(3) (Ln = Eu, Tb, Er, Yb) using different diagnostic techniques. The rare-earth, oxygen and carbon concentrations have been determined by Rutherford backscattering spectroscopy and nuclear reaction analysis. The films have smooth surfaces with typical roughness the sizes of which have been changed with chemical modification. According to the results on nuclear microanalysis and IR spectroscopy the assumptions about the local environment of the rare-earth ions in amorphous matrix can be suggested. (c) 2007 Elsevier Ltd.
